Dave Stewart A no-holds-barred look into the remarkable life and career of the prolific musician, songwriter, and producer behind Eurythmics and dozens of pop hits. Dave Stewartâs life has been a wild rideâone filled with music, constant reinvention, and the never-ending drive to create. Growing up outside of London, he turned to music after an injury ended his football career, and left his idyllic home for the gritty London streets of the â70s, where he began collaborating and performing with various musicians, including a young waitress named Annie Lennox.The chemistry between Stewart and Lennox was undeniable, and an intense romance developed. While their passion proved too much off-stage, they thrived musically and developed their own sound. They called themselves Eurythmics, and launched into global stardom with the massively popular album, âSweet Dreams (Are Made of This).âFor the first time, Stewart shares the never-before-told stories of his life in musicâthe drugs and the parties, the A-list collaborations and relationships, and the creative process that brought us blockbusters like Tom Pettyâs âDonât Come Around Here No More,â Bon Joviâs âMidnight in Chelsea,â Celine Dionâs âTaking Chance,â and many more.
